Approval of an Appropriation Ordinance for the 2012 HOME Investment Partnerships (HOME) Program. The Office of Housing and Community Development (OHCD) anticipates the State' s Hawaii Housing Finance and Development Corporation (HHFDC) approval of the County' s 2012 Action Plan by July 1, 2012 . In anticipation of HHFDC' s approval and in order to administer the HOME projects, the OHCD will need an appropriation ordinance to expend the 2012 HOME funds . This year the State will implement a new method in allocating the HOME program funds . The HOME program funds will be allocated on a three year rotation basis beginning with Hawai 'i County followed by Kauai County and Maui County. The designated County will receive the entire allocation of HOME funding, less 2 . 5% of the allowable administrative funding which will be retained by the State' s Hawaii Housing Finance and Development Corporation (HHFDC) to cover program administrative expenses (approximately $75, 000) . The County of Hawaii anticipates it will receive approximately $2, 925, 000. 00 for the 2012 HOME Program. In addition, the County anticipates receiving $25, 000. 00 of program income for a total of $2, 950, 000. 00 of HOME funds . The HOME project amount for all projects may change to accommodate the actual allocation of HOME project funds, program income received or if there are any cancelled or reprogramming of HOME funds . The Administration amount will change to the actual allocation of Administration funds received from the HHFDC, including 10% of actual program income received by the County. The OHCD is requesting approval of the attached appropriation ordinance by the Hawaii County Housing Agency, and its recommendation for adoption by the Hawai'i County Council. The OHCD emphasizes that no County General Funds are involved in these transactions.
